
1. Grease and flour a 10-inch fluted tube pan; set aside.
2. Prepare brownie mix according to package directions for cake brownies; spread batter into the prepared pan.
3. Bake in a 325 degree F oven for 40 to 45 minutes or until toothpick inserted near center of cake comes out clean. Cool in pan on wire rack for 10 minutes. Remove from pan. Cool thoroughly on rack.
4. Tint frosting with green food coloring to desired color. Decorate cake with frosting and candies. Wrap well and store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. Makes 24 servings.
Note: The outer crust will soften and cut easier if you wrap and store the wreath overnight
To Present This As a Gift: You will need a round plate, scissors, red construction paper, tape, and marking pens (optional).
First wash and dry the plate. Place brownie wreath in the center. Cut a bow shape from red pepper. Cut an oval for the bow center. Use a ring of tape to secure bow center. Personalize bow with marking pens, if desired. Place bow at the top of the brownie ring.
Also Try This: Instead of a construction-paper bow, use a ribbon bow for the wreath's finishing touch.
